logo

Output 650d52f64a0365541ddaac0587fccff07d2e2418aa81bf6e84b0a007a520439b:4

value
2103162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d52c8e1234aeabff696e35d921a7665fe9bac6f OP_EQUAL
address
35pfWA44SKEQ5DJAtTKWA8r4pKuUqv51rN
transaction
650d52f64a0365541ddaac0587fccff07d2e2418aa81bf6e84b0a007a520439b